Residential Fumigation in Long Island, NY
Residential fumigation services involve the controlled application of fumigants to eliminate pests such as termites, bed bugs, and other invasive insects from homes and other residential properties. These treatments are typically used for severe infestations or when other pest control methods have proven ineffective. Projects may include entire homes, attics, basements, or specific areas where pests are active. Property owners should understand that fumigation is a comprehensive process that often requires temporary evacuation and preparation to ensure safety and effectiveness.
Before requesting residential fumigation, homeowners usually want to know about the scope of the treatment, including which areas will be affected and the necessary precautions during and after the process. It’s also important to understand the duration of the treatment, any property protections needed, and post-treatment inspections or follow-up services. Proper planning and clear communication can help ensure the treatment addresses pest issues effectively while maintaining safety for residents and their belongings.

Residential Fumigation Questions
What is residential fumigation? Residential fumigation involves treating a home to eliminate pests such as termites, bed bugs, or other insects through controlled gas application.
When is fumigation recommended? Fumigation is typically recommended for severe infestations or pests that are difficult to control with standard treatments.
How should homeowners prepare for fumigation? Preparation may include removing food, plants, and personal belongings, and following specific instructions to ensure safety and effectiveness.
Are there any post-fumigation precautions? After fumigation, it’s advised to ventilate the property thoroughly and wait for clearance before re-entering, as directed by the service provider.
